to lose one's trust in somebody or something
01

to no longer have confidence or faith in the honesty, reliability, or intentions of someone or something

He has already lost his trust in the financial advisor who gave him poor investment advice.
After discovering that he had been dishonest about his finances, she lost her trust in him.
She has lost her trust in online dating after a series of disappointing experiences.
